首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

具有同步和事件的Dynamic Vue组件

是指在Vue.js框架中,可以动态加载和渲染的组件,并且具备同步和事件处理的能力。

概念:

Dynamic Vue组件是指在Vue.js中,可以通过动态组件的方式来加载和渲染的组件。它可以根据不同的条件或用户交互来动态地切换不同的组件,从而实现灵活的页面布局和功能。

分类:

Dynamic Vue组件可以根据加载方式进行分类,常见的分类包括:

  1. 异步组件:异步组件是指在需要时才会进行加载和渲染的组件。它可以通过Vue的异步组件语法来定义,或者通过Webpack等构建工具进行代码分割,实现按需加载。
  2. 条件渲染组件:条件渲染组件是指根据条件来动态切换不同的组件。可以通过Vue的条件渲染指令(v-if、v-else-if、v-else)来实现。

优势:

使用Dynamic Vue组件具有以下优势:

  1. 灵活性:Dynamic Vue组件可以根据不同的条件或用户交互来动态加载和渲染不同的组件,使页面布局和功能更加灵活。
  2. 代码复用:通过将不同的组件封装成Dynamic Vue组件,可以实现组件的复用,减少重复代码的编写。
  3. 性能优化:异步加载组件可以减少初始加载时的资源消耗,提高页面加载速度和性能。

应用场景:

Dynamic Vue组件适用于以下场景:

  1. 复杂的页面布局:当页面布局需要根据不同的条件或用户交互来动态切换不同的组件时,可以使用Dynamic Vue组件实现灵活的布局。
  2. 按需加载:当页面中的某些组件只在特定条件下才需要加载时,可以使用异步组件实现按需加载,提高页面加载性能。
  3. 动态表单:当需要根据用户选择的不同选项来动态生成表单字段时,可以使用Dynamic Vue组件实现动态表单。

推荐的腾讯云相关产品:

腾讯云提供了一系列与云计算相关的产品和服务,以下是一些推荐的产品和产品介绍链接地址:

  1. 云服务器(CVM):腾讯云的云服务器产品,提供弹性计算能力,支持多种操作系统。产品介绍链接
  2. 云数据库MySQL版(CDB):腾讯云的关系型数据库产品,提供高可用、可扩展的MySQL数据库服务。产品介绍链接
  3. 云函数(SCF):腾讯云的无服务器函数计算产品,支持事件驱动的函数计算。产品介绍链接
  4. 人工智能平台(AI Lab):腾讯云的人工智能平台,提供多种人工智能服务和工具,如图像识别、语音识别等。产品介绍链接

请注意,以上推荐的产品仅为示例,实际选择产品时应根据具体需求进行评估和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

9分8秒

Vue3.x项目全程实录 17_Vant组件库的使用图片懒加载和徽章 学习猿地

14分19秒

Vue3.x全家桶 2_认识一下Vue 学习猿地

10分34秒

Vue3.x全家桶 1_Vue3框架课程内容介绍 学习猿地

28分25秒

Vue3.x全家桶 3_Vue3的CDN方式安装和基本开发功能体验 学习猿地

1分0秒

光伏发电可视化

14分28秒

jQuery教程-01-$是函数名

1时5分

APP和小程序实战开发 | 基础开发和引擎模块特性

1分42秒

时统设备 b码时统 时统系统 时统设备 时统终端 时间统一系统 gps天文钟 时统 天文时钟

3分8秒

智能振弦传感器参数智能识别技术:简化工作流程,提高工作效率的利器

37秒

智能振弦传感器介绍

1分53秒

JSP贸易管理系统myeclipse开发mysql数据库struts编程java语言

2分4秒

光学雨量计红外雨量传感器测量原理(1)

领券